It was discovered on 15 August 1939, by German astronomer Karl Reinmuth at Heidelberg Observatory in southern Germany.
[2] Brahms orbits the Sun in the inner main-belt at a distance of 1.8–2.6 AU once every 3 years and 2 months (1,163 days).
[4] As of 2017, Brahms effective size, albedo and spectral type, as well as its rotation period and shape remain unknown.
Based on a magnitude-to-diameter conversion, its generic diameter is between 5 and 11 kilometer for an absolute magnitude of 13.8, and an assumed albedo in the range of 0.05 to 0.25.
[3] Since asteroids in the inner main-belt are typically of stony rather than carbonaceous composition, with albedos of 0.20 or higher, Brahms's diameter can be estimate to measure around 6 kilometers, as the higher its albedo (reflectivity), the lower the body's diameter at a constant absolute magnitude (brightness).
